There are 99 names of Allah. Allah the Almighty, says in the Qur’an a kareem: ‘Wa lillahil asma’il husna fad’uhu bi ha’ ‘And to Allah belong all the best names, so call Him by them’ [‘al A’raf; 180]
WebThe God of the Qur’an has many of the same attributes as the Christian God, for He is omnipresent, omniscient, and omnipotent. Allah is also considered to be eternal, holy, unchangeable; the Judge. Muslims also believe in angels and demons. The Muslim and Christian views of God have some similarities. Christians believe in one eternal God Who created the universe, and Muslims apply these attributes to Allah. Both view God as all-powerful, all-knowing, and all-present.
